Publisher Description

The Believer’s Paradox is an outstanding work that deals with the presence of unbelief in the believer. A.W. Pink has taken the prayer of Mark 9:24: “Lord, I believe; help thou mine unbelief,” to illustrate this paradox. In the author’s solution of the paradox, and in his rich exposition of the prayer, readers will find wise instruction and great comfort for the soul.
